From the start codon through the stop codon, the length of the
fully processed AURKA mRNA is 1,212 nucleotides. Calculate the number of amino
acids in the polypeptide chain coded for by the mRNA.

Respuesta :

Answer:

404 amino acids  

Explanation:

The translation is the process by which a messenger RNA (mRNA) molecule is used as a template to synthesize a protein in the ribosomes. During translation, each triplet of nucleotides or 'codon' determines one specific amino acid of the growing polypeptide chain (i.e., the protein). In this case, the length of the fully processed AURKA mRNA consists of 1,212 nucleotides, thereby the length of the polypeptide chain will be 404 amino acids (protein length = 1,212 / 3 = 404 amino acids).
